diff --git a/src/NHibernate.Test/Async/NHSpecificTest/GH1300/Fixture.cs b/src/NHibernate.Test/Async/NHSpecificTest/GH1300/Fixture.cs index 3ead1a0369d..790834cdc9f 100644 --- a/src/NHibernate.Test/Async/NHSpecificTest/GH1300/Fixture.cs +++ b/src/NHibernate.Test/Async/NHSpecificTest/GH1300/Fixture.cs @@ -114,7 +114,9 @@ public void InsertWithTooLongValuesShouldThrowAsync() var sqlEx = ex.InnerException as SqlException; Assert.That(sqlEx, Is.Not.Null); - Assert.That(sqlEx.Number, Is.EqualTo(8152)); + // Error code is different if verbose truncation warning is enabled + // See details: https://www.brentozar.com/archive/2019/03/how-to-fix-the-error-string-or-binary-data-would-be-truncated/ + Assert.That(sqlEx.Number, Is.EqualTo(8152).Or.EqualTo(2628)); } } diff --git a/src/NHibernate.Test/NHSpecificTest/GH1300/Fixture.cs b/src/NHibernate.Test/NHSpecificTest/GH1300/Fixture.cs index 8f994c19117..690d5e9eb6c 100644 --- a/src/NHibernate.Test/NHSpecificTest/GH1300/Fixture.cs +++ b/src/NHibernate.Test/NHSpecificTest/GH1300/Fixture.cs @@ -103,7 +103,9 @@ public void InsertWithTooLongValuesShouldThrow() var sqlEx = ex.InnerException as SqlException; Assert.That(sqlEx, Is.Not.Null); - Assert.That(sqlEx.Number, Is.EqualTo(8152)); + // Error code is different if verbose truncation warning is enabled + // See details: https://www.brentozar.com/archive/2019/03/how-to-fix-the-error-string-or-binary-data-would-be-truncated/ + Assert.That(sqlEx.Number, Is.EqualTo(8152).Or.EqualTo(2628)); } }